Transaction 40fd59d1c4f064b5a048fb24d756656ecc8d7662b8e55b383b250a723d638331

1 Input
2 Outputs
  • 40fd59d1c4f064b5a048fb24d756656ecc8d7662b8e55b383b250a723d638331:0
  • value  1787314669
    address  17RphU8NN2dYbWwhBjyN3jK7fF4Nj88gAW
  • 40fd59d1c4f064b5a048fb24d756656ecc8d7662b8e55b383b250a723d638331:1
  • value  1480155
    address  3M4Swf2zRA76YFWxhnYqnqSU4n4t1Ckcys